Nepal unrest: High alert sounded along border

High alert was sounded along the Indo-Nepal border here due to the unrest in Nepal, in which 11 persons including an Indian national were killed.
Sashastra Seema Bal (SSB) officers visited the border post at Koilabasa and held a meeting with Nepal authorities.
SSB officiating Commandant Hare Krishna Gupta said he had visited the border check-post and instructed the jawans to maintain strong vigil along the Indo-Nepal border.
Gupta also spoke to his counterparts in Daang district of Nepal over phone.
He said SSB jawans carrying out surveillance along the border, along with police forces of Nepal and Uttar Pradesh, and forest officials.
Violent protests erupted in Nepal against the proposed new Constitution.
